Chester, NJ Hairstylist Billy Del Russo, 34, Dies; Sister Maria Mourns ‘The Light’ of Their Family

William Patrick “Billy” Del Russo, Jr., a 34-year-old hairstylist from New Jersey known for his infectious personality and warm heart, passed away on June 5, 2026.

His sister Maria shared the news on Instagram, writing that Billy was “the light” of their family and that his passing has left a hole that can never be filled.

Born on July 12, 1991, Billy grew up in Chester, New Jersey, and graduated from Mendham High School before attending the Artistic Academy for Hair.

That training launched a career that took him across salons in New York and New Jersey, where he built deep, lasting relationships with clients who often became lifelong friends. Among his most treasured professional accomplishments was traveling to Paris as a stylist for the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show, a milestone he spoke of with great pride.

Those who knew Billy describe him as someone who never met a stranger. His warmth and humor could fill any room, and he had a rare talent for making people feel genuinely seen and cared for.

Colleagues remembered his encouragement and generosity. One tribute on his funeral home’s memorial page described how Billy stopped into a friend’s newly opened shop just to congratulate them and offer words of encouragement. Another wrote that he was the kind of person whose kindness, warmth, and positive energy touched everyone he met.

Summers at the Shore and a Family-First Spirit

Outside of work, Billy found his happiest moments surrounded by family and friends. He was a fixture at summer gatherings along the Jersey Shore, particularly in Manasquan and Mantoloking, and at the family beach house on Chadwick Beach Island.

Known as the life of every party, he had a gift for humor that came naturally and effortlessly.

Family was everything to Billy. He rarely missed a gathering or celebration, and his bond with his cousins was especially close. His large extended family in both New York and New Jersey kept him grounded, and he treasured every moment spent with them.

Maria’s Instagram tribute, which drew hundreds of comments from friends, colleagues, and followers, captured the grief felt across communities that Billy touched throughout his life. She wrote that she and her husband Ben will raise their children knowing they have two uncles, and that Uncle Billy is loving them from heaven.

Billy is survived by his parents, Diane and William, his sister Maria and her husband Ben, and his brother Anthony and his fiancée Alessandra, along with a wide circle of relatives and friends.

A visitation will be held on Wednesday, June 10, 2026, from 4 to 8 p.m. at the William J. Leber Funeral Home, located at 15 Furnace Road in Chester, New Jersey. The funeral service and interment will be private, held by his immediate family. The family has asked guests to be considerate of others waiting to share their condolences, as a large attendance is expected.

Billy Del Russo was 34 years old. He is remembered as someone who lived with his whole heart and gave generously of himself to everyone around him.
